The Loyola Social Justice Law Clinic (LSJLC) is a diverse collective of legal clinics that strives to create more equitable, inclusive, and compassionate legal systems by teaching future attorneys advocacy skills that respect the inherent dignity of each client they serve. Our mission is to train students through live-client advocacy to provide the highest quality, holistic legal services to under-resourced individuals and their communities in a diverse collective of local-to-global practice areas; to turn knowledge and practice into action that advances clients' access to justice while bearing witness to individual and structural inequality; and to demand accountability leading to the reform of justice systems. The Communications Lead will coordinate, produce, and execute communications efforts and activities for the LSJLC at LMU Loyola Law School. Integrated and supervised within Marketing, Communications, and External Relations (MarComm), this position is responsible for developing and implementing a robust communications plan in close partnership with LSJLC's executive director. This plan will address both strategic storytelling and operational communications (event promotion, client outreach, and student recruitment). The ideal candidate will craft compelling written and visual content that engages donors, students, alumni, community stakeholders, and the general public. Their work will support enrollment marketing, elevate LSJLC's visibility, and position the clinics as a thought and action leader in legal advocacy and social justice. The incumbent develops and pursues strategies and tactics that promote a positive institutional image, reinforce brand narratives, and increase engagement with target audiences. All communications will align with the university brand, foster community awareness and transparency, and deepen understanding of LSJLC's mission and impact. Position Specific Responsibilities/Accountabilities Maximize LSJLC's exposure and visibility by designing and implementing communications strategies that engage target audiences, elevate the clinics' visibility in legal advocacy and social justice, and strengthen brand awareness. Ensure efforts integrate with the goals of LMU Loyola Law School and the university's broader Marketing, Communications, and External Relations division. Cultivate and steward relationships with donors, alumni, community stakeholders, and members of the news media. Seek opportunities to extend LSJLC's reach and influence to advance its mission and public engagement objectives. Support the day-to-day communications needs of LSJLC. Research, design, produce, write, and/or edit copy for traditional or digital documents and publications, including, but not limited to: letters, websites, publicity materials for special events, articles, presentations, talking points, and other general communications. Collaborate with LSJLC faculty and staff on developing content. Serve as the primary liaison between LLS/LMU MarComm and LSJLC, facilitating cross-departmental collaboration to accomplish shared goals and assuring alignment of strategies and protocols. Coordinate with MarComm colleagues to ensure alignment of communications efforts and goals with the university's overall communications strategy. Coordinate with LLS MarComm on media outreach and response. In consultation with LSJLC leadership, MarComm, and University Advancement, plan and execute regular alumni communications, donor relations communications, and other LSJLC fundraising campaigns or communications, and create additional materials to support Advancement's engagement with donors as needed. Collaborate with MarComm to develop content that supports enrollment marketing and communications, faculty promotional communications, and the Dean's communications with internal and external stakeholders. Manage LSJLC social channels. Engage and increase audiences by crafting posts, campaigns, and a social media plan that supports LSJLC objectives. Collect and maintain information on events, lectures, and activities sponsored by LSJLC in the university's online calendar of events and ensure active internal communications engagement to elevate awareness of LSJLC efforts. Promote LSJLC events to the general public and targeted audiences. Research and assist in the preparation, writing and submission of grant proposals and reports, and related requests. Collaborate with MarComm Digital Strategy and Solutions team to refresh, redevelop, and deploy updated LSJLC websites. Develop an online content maintenance plan that ensures the timely updates of news, events, and general content for LSJLC. Ensure projects are completed by identified deadlines and on budget. Assure successful outcomes by adopting best-practice project management methodologies, quality assurance metrics, and risk mitigation plans.
